Course Details

Fundamentals of Photojournalism: Understanding the basics of photojournalism, its history, and ethical considerations.
Camera Techniques for Photojournalists: Learning about camera equipment, settings, and techniques to capture compelling images.
Storytelling through Visual Imagery: Developing the ability to convey stories and messages through photography.
Editing and Post-Processing: Mastering photo editing software for enhancing images and maintaining consistency.
Connecting with Audiences: Exploring strategies to engage and captivate the target audience through visual storytelling.
Social Media and Online Platforms: Utilizing social media and online platforms to reach and expand audiences.
Legal and Ethical Considerations in Photojournalism: Understanding legal and ethical issues in photojournalism, including copyright, privacy, and consent.
Visual Design and Composition: Developing an eye for visual design and composition to create visually appealing images.
Career Development in Photojournalism: Preparing for a career in photojournalism, including portfolio development, job searching, and networking.
